Mucoadhesive, antioxidant, and lubricant catechol-functionalized poly(phosphobetaine) as biomaterial nanotherapeutics for treating ocular dryness

Published in 2024 at "Journal of Nanobiotechnology"

DOI: 10.1186/s12951-024-02448-x

Abstract: Dry eye disease (DED) is associated with ocular hyperosmolarity and inflammation. The marketed topical eye drops for DED treatment often lack bioavailability and precorneal residence time.
